Project Offbeat

Lance Cham and Matt Yu

Welcome to Project Offbeat! Lance and Matt here, just two corporate guys looking to expand their perspectives. We created this podcast to bring you "offbeat" stories, from guests with unconventional careers OUTSIDE the usual corporate setup. Are you ready to take the #OffTheBeatenPath?
